Geography of Billings
Billings, Montana, the state's largest city and the seat of Yellowstone County. The city is on the Yellowstone River and is a trade and shipping center for a highly irrigated region that produces wool, dairy products, livestock, and alfalfa. Billings has meat-packing plants, flour mills, and beet sugar and oil refineries. Rocky Mountain College and Montana State University-Billings are here. Pictograph Cave State Monument, with ancient Indian wall writing, is nearby. Billings was founded in 1882.
Population: 89,847.
